#3d9de8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3d9de8 is composed of 23.9% red, 61.6%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.7% cyan, 32.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 206.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.8% and a lightness of 57.5%. #3d9de8 color hex could be obtained by blending #7affff with #003bd1.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#3d9de8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a10 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d9de8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#909395 is the less saturated color, while #2c9ff9 is the most saturated one.
